Making your own pancake batter mix is easier than you think and offers a delicious, customizable alternative to store-bought mixes. This guide will walk you through the key aspects of creating your perfect pancake batter mix, ensuring fluffy, flavorful pancakes every time.

Understanding the Ingredients: The Foundation of Great Pancake Batter

The beauty of homemade pancake batter mix lies in its simplicity and control over ingredients. Here's a breakdown of the essential components:

1. Flour Power: Choosing the Right Flour

The type of flour significantly impacts the texture of your pancakes.

  • All-Purpose Flour: The most common choice, providing a good balance of texture and flavor.
  • Whole Wheat Flour: Adds a nuttier flavor and more fiber, resulting in slightly denser pancakes. Adjust liquid accordingly, as whole wheat flour absorbs more.
  • Gluten-Free Flour Blend: For those with dietary restrictions, a high-quality gluten-free blend will produce delicious pancakes. Experiment with different blends to find your preference.

Pro Tip: Sifting your flour before measuring ensures a light and airy batter, preventing lumps.

2. Sweetening the Deal: Sugar and Flavor

Sugar adds sweetness and helps with browning. Experiment with different types:

  • Granulated Sugar: The standard choice for a balanced sweetness.
  • Brown Sugar: Adds a deeper, richer flavor and moisture.
  • Honey or Maple Syrup: For a more natural sweetness, use these sparingly, as they can impact the texture.

3. Leavening Agents: The Rise and Fall

Leavening agents are crucial for achieving fluffy pancakes. A combination is often best:

  • Baking Powder: Provides the primary leavening, creating air bubbles for a light texture. Ensure it's fresh for optimal results.
  • Baking Soda: Often used in conjunction with baking powder, especially if you're using acidic ingredients like buttermilk.

4. Salt: Enhancing the Flavor Profile

A pinch of salt is essential! It balances the sweetness and enhances the overall flavor of the pancakes. Don't skip it!

Creating Your Custom Pancake Batter Mix: A Step-by-Step Guide

Ingredients:

  • 4 cups all-purpose flour (or your preferred flour blend)
  • 1/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 4 teaspoons baking powder
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1 teaspoon salt

Instructions:

  1. Whisk Dry Ingredients: In a large bowl, whisk together the flour, sugar, baking powder, baking soda, and salt. Ensure everything is well combined.
  2. Store Properly: Transfer the mixture to an airtight container. Store it in a cool, dry place. This mix can last for several months.
  3. Making the Pancakes: When ready to make pancakes, combine the dry mix with your liquid ingredients (milk, eggs, melted butter, etc.) according to your chosen recipe.

Tips for Perfect Pancakes Every Time

  • Don't Overmix: Overmixing develops gluten, leading to tough pancakes. Mix only until the ingredients are just combined.
  • Let the Batter Rest: Allowing the batter to rest for 5-10 minutes allows the gluten to relax and the leavening agents to activate, resulting in fluffier pancakes.
  • Cook at the Right Temperature: Medium heat is ideal. If the pancakes are browning too quickly, reduce the heat.
  • Flip Only Once: Flip your pancakes only once they have bubbles forming on the surface and the edges look set.
